The Enemy is among us . . .First the sickness rotted the adults' minds. Then their bodies. Now they stalk the streets of London, hunting human flesh. The Holloway crew are survivors. They've fought their way across the city and made it to the Natural History Museum alive--just barely. But their fight will never end while the Enemy lives, unless there's another way.
The Holloway crew has made it to the Natural History Museum, but when the children return to the streets for medical supplies, it is no longer clear who or what is their enemy. The plot contains profanity and violence. Book #5
